Clarification on Lumico’s Underwriting Process

Clarification on Lumico’s Underwriting Process It has been mentioned by several agents that during the underwriting process Milliman RX Rules has been making underwriting decisions, based on the drugs they show for an individual applying for Lumico’s medicare supplement plans. We believe this is happening because when a client is declined due to a particular drug or combination of drugs we suggest the applicant contact Milliman to see and confirm the drugs they have listed are actually correct. The results received from Milliman are then reviewed by Lumico for a underwriting decision. Milliman in no way makes these underwriting decisions

Lumico Rate Adjustment (Indiana)

Lumico received approval for a rate adjustment in Indiana, effective September 1, 2019. Any application dated on or after August 9, 2019 requesting a policy effective date before September 1, 2019 will receive the current rates. Any application dated on or after August 9, 2019 requesting a policy effective date of September 1, 2019 or after will receive the new rates. MACRA Changes

As carriers begin to release High Deductible G rates for MACRA, CSG Actuarial will be adding them to the MarketAdvisor quoting tool. Agents can select High Deductible G from the plan selection list, but must enter an effective date of 1-1-2020 to view results. New Carrier Added to CSG E-Application Platform

On July 1, CSG Actuarial added Heartland National Life Insurance Company to the Medicare Supplement E-Application Platform. Agents can submit applications in 10 states – DE, IA, MD, NC, ND, NM, OH, PA, SD and WV. Heartland offers Plans A, G, N in all 10 states with a subset of states offering Plans B and/or C. Heartland will be releasing additional states later this year. Heartland National Life is the third carrier to be added to the E-Application Platform. AM Best Upgrades GTL’s Financial Strength Rating to A-

  We are extremely excited to announce that AM Best has upgraded GTL’s Financial Strength Rating to A- (Excellent) from B++ (Good) by AM Best! GTL’s Long Term Issuer Credit Rating was also upgraded to “a-“. In today’s press release, AM Best noted that the upgrade reflects GTL’s strong balance sheet strength as well as our strong operating performance. Gerber Life Discontinuing Medicare Supplement New Business Sales

July 03, 2019 Closing New Business Effective August 1, 2019 Gerber Life Insurance Company will no longer accept new business applications for Medicare supplement sales. Inforce Business There is no impact to existing business. Gerber Life will continue to service all existing Medicare supplement policies. Agent Contracting New producer contracts will no longer be accepted for Medicare supplements as of July 3, 2019. Medicare supplement contracts and appointments will be terminated. Agents contracted with Gerber Life to sell both Medicare supplement and Gerber’s other product lines will only have their Medicare supplement contract terminated. Lumico MACRA Revised Outlines of Coverage

In compliance with the requirements of the Medicare Access and CHIP Reauthorization Act of 2015 (MACRA), the Outline of Coverage has been revised. The benefit chart has been revised to reflect Plan C and F are only available to applicants that were first eligible for Medicare before January 1, 2020. Agents should begin using the revised outlines effective July 1, 2019 since this is the earliest date open enrollment applicants may start applying for coverage with a January 1, 2020 effective date.
